ArthaLand wins Best Eco Developer in CFI.co Awards
ArthaLand has asserted its position as the top advocate for sustainability in the country when it received from the Capital Finance International (CFI. co) the award for Best Eco Property Developer in the Philippines. This award recognizes the sustainability efforts, design language, and decisionmaking process that ArthaLand has dedicated to all its projects. “We are honored to be given this recognition because we believe that it puts the Philippines on the map for upholding best practices for eco awareness in property development,” said Jaime C. At the heart of every ArthaLand project is sustainability, which, together with exceptional and innovative design coupled with highquality construction standards, has been the main thrust in all its developments. Arya Residences in Bonifacio Global City is the first and only residential building in the country to receive the dual certification comprising of the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design (LEED) Gold certification from the US Green Building Council and the Building for Ecologically Responsive Design Excellence (BERDE) 4-star certification by the Philippine Green Building Council. Another green project under its wing is the ArthaLand Century Pacific Tower (ACPT), a premium grade office development also in Bonifacio Global City which was the recipient of the Best Green Development and Highly Commended in the Best Office Architectural Design categories of the Philippine Property Awards. It has received both LEED Platinum rating and just recently, BERDE 5-star certification, the highest and most prestigious categories in both green building rating standards. ArthaLand’s commitment to the environment is not just limited to its projects. Even in its operations, ArthaLand espouses best practices in construction. The company is currently in the midst of constructing at the gateway of the Cebu IT Park the single largest green office building in the country, the Cebu Exchange. All construction workers at its project site are educated about environmental issues today and are asked to commit to a sustainable or green action in their everyday lives. For example, many workers volunteer to give a pledge to discourage singleuse plastics or to segregate the waste in their homes or offices. This highlights the company’s commitment and initiative towards spreading environmental awareness within its own sphere of influence.
